High Street, Hastings, 1937This image shows a street scene. A hotel is on the corner on the right hand side and shop fronts can be seen lining both sides of the street. Motor cars are parked on either side of the street and a light coloured car can be seen driving towards the camera. The following is printed across the bottom of the photograph: “The Rose Series P. 13940 High Street, Hastings, Vic.”.

House and family, c. 1910This image shows a family sitting and standing on the verandah of a four posted brick cottage, posing for a photo. They are all very well dressed. The man on the left is holding a baby girl. The woman is sitting on a chair and the man on the right has one foot on a step and the other on the ground. Two windows with lace curtains are on either side of a wooden door.
